*Sasanarakkha [Guardian of the Sasana] is a compound formed from the Pali words sasana and arakkha . For Theravada Buddhists, Sasana is an abbreviation of Buddhasasana [the Buddha's Teaching], which is basically three-fold: to study, practise and realise the Dhammavinaya. Arakkha means guardian or protector.
